Key Features to Look for in an Upright Vacuum Cleaner

Choosing the best upright vacuum cleaner requires understanding its key features. The right vacuum can simplify cleaning and improve efficiency. Here are the crucial features to examine:

Dust Capacity and Bag Type

Consider the vacuum’s dust capacity. Larger dust bins mean less frequent emptying. Some models use bags, while others have bagless designs. Bagged vacuums are great for minimizing dust exposure, ideal for allergies. Bagless designs are more cost-effective but require regular cleaning of filters.

Weight and Maneuverability

Weight is an important factor, particularly for multi-floor homes. Lightweight vacuums are easier to carry and glide across different surfaces. Maneuverability ensures the vacuum can move around furniture and tight spaces seamlessly. Choose a model with a swivel mechanism for better handling.

Filtration Systems and HEPA Filters

A vacuum’s filtration system impacts air quality in your home. HEPA filters are excellent for trapping allergens and improving air purity. They are a must-have for allergy sufferers and homes with pets. Look for vacuums with washable or replaceable filters for convenience.

Corded vs. Cordless Options

Decide between corded and cordless options. Corded vacuums provide consistent power and are ideal for large spaces. Cordless models offer convenience and portability but require battery charging. Consider run time and battery life for cordless vacuums to ensure extended use.

Maintenance and Tips for Upright Vacuum Cleaners

Keeping your best upright vacuum cleaner running smoothly requires proper care and maintenance. Follow these tips to ensure its efficiency and longevity.

Proper Cleaning and Storage

  • Empty the dust bin or replace bags after each use to prevent clogging.
  • Clean the brush roll regularly to remove hair, threads, or debris.
  • Wipe the vacuum’s exterior with a damp cloth to maintain its appearance.
  • Store the vacuum in a cool, dry place to avoid damage from moisture or heat.
  • Wrap the cord neatly to prevent tangles and extend its lifespan.

Regular Filter Replacements

  • Check the filters every few months to see if they need cleaning or replacement.
  • Wash washable filters following the manufacturer’s instructions and ensure they are completely dry.
  • Replace non-washable filters as recommended, typically every 6–12 months.
  • A clean filter ensures strong suction and better air quality.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

  • If suction decreases, check for clogs in hoses or blockages in the dust bin.
  • Replace or clean the brush roll if it stops spinning properly.
  • Inspect cords for damage to avoid electrical issues.
  • If the vacuum overheats, turn it off and let it cool before restarting.
  • Read the user manual for guidance on specific issues and fixes.

Frequently Asked Questions about Upright Vacuum Cleaners

How Often Should You Vacuum Your Home?

Vacuuming frequency depends on your lifestyle, household size, and flooring type. Homes with kids or pets require vacuuming several times a week to manage hair and dirt. High-traffic areas, like living rooms, benefit from daily cleaning. For less-used spaces, vacuuming once a week is often sufficient. Regular vacuuming keeps allergens at bay and helps maintain a clean environment.

Is a Lightweight Model Better for Stairs?

Lightweight vacuums are ideal for cleaning stairs. They are easier to carry and maneuver. Look for models with detachable canisters or handheld configurations. These features make stair cleaning more manageable. Swivel mechanisms and long cords simplify navigating tight spaces and edges. Cordless options also work well for quick stair cleanups.

Can Upright Vacuums Clean Both Carpets and Hard Floors?

Yes, many upright vacuums clean carpets and hard floors effectively. Multi-surface capability is key for versatility. Look for models with adjustable height settings or brush rolls for smooth transitions between surfaces. Some vacuums even auto-detect floor types to optimize settings. Tips for Choosing the Right Vacuum Cleaner for Your Needs

1. Assessing Your Home Environment

When selecting the best upright vacuum cleaner, the environment in which you live is a critical consideration. The type of flooring you have—whether it’s carpet, hardwood, tile, or a combination—will influence which vacuum best suits your needs. Carpets may require stronger suction and a rotating brush to agitate the fibers, while hardwood floors benefit from vacuums that minimize scratches and collect debris efficiently.

Considering Pet Ownership

If you have pets, take into account the additional challenges presented by pet hair and dander. Some vacuums are specifically designed for pet owners, featuring stronger suction and specialized attachments to effectively remove hair and allergens. Understanding your specific cleaning needs will help narrow down your options, ensuring you choose a vacuum that handles your unique challenges.
